Belden 1814R audio snake cable is 2-22 AWG tinned copper pairs, polyolefin insulation, individually shielded with Beldfoil bonded to numbered/color-coded PVC jackets so both strip simultaneously, rip cord, and PVC jacket. Riser rated (CMR).
Belden analog multi-pair snake cables are used to connect multiple audio channels in low-level (microphone) and high-level (line) configurations, such as console board
equipment for recording studios, radio television stations, post-production facilities and sound system installations. With Belden individually shielded and jacketed snakes, pairs can be split out of the overall jacket for any length and connected directly without the need for heat shrink tubing or costly and time-consuming preparation. With Beldfoil individually shielded and jacketed pairs these are high-performance cables excellent for long runs.
